Market Overview

Aeroengine composites are advanced materials, primarily carbon fiber reinforced polymers and other fiber-reinforced composites, used in the construction of aircraft jet engines to reduce weight, improve fuel efficiency, and enhance thermal resistance. The aeroengine composites market encompasses advanced materials used in the manufacture of jet engine components including fan blades, casings, nacelles, and combustor parts. Carbon fiber reinforced polymers (CFRP) represent the dominant material type due to their high strength-to-weight ratio and resistance to elevated temperatures found in modern high-bypass turbofan engines. The broader aerospace composites sector, which includes aeroengine applications, is expected to reach over $50 billion by 2030, with engine-related composites representing a significant and growing portion of that total.

Growth Drivers

The push for greater aircraft fuel efficiency and reduced emissions is the primary driver, as composite materials enable engine weight reductions of 20-50% compared to traditional metal alloys. New engine programs such as geared turbofans and advanced high-bypass ratio engines increasingly incorporate composite components in both structural and hot-section applications. Military aircraft modernization programs and the demand for next-generation unmanned aerial vehicles also contribute to sustained market expansion.

Segmentation and Regional Analysis

The market can be segmented by material type, predominantly carbon fiber composites, glass fiber composites, and other advanced resins, as well as by engine component type including fan blades, casings, and nacelle parts. North America and Europe currently dominate the market due to the concentration of major aircraft and engine manufacturers, while the Asia-Pacific region is emerging as the fastest-growing market driven by increasing aircraft production and maintenance activity. Commercial aviation represents the largest application segment, though military and business jet engines also contribute meaningfully to overall demand.

Trends and Outlook

What are the recent trends and outlook?

Emerging technologies such as ceramic matrix composites and advanced thermoplastic composites are expected to expand the addressable market by enabling use in hotter sections of next-generation engines where traditional polymer composites cannot operate. Automation in composite manufacturing, including automated fiber placement and out-of-autoclave processes, is reducing production costs and improving quality consistency for high-volume applications.
